VBA -lokitoiminto

Loki Kuvaus

Palauttaa luvun luonnollisen logaritmin.

Yksinkertaisia ​​lokiesimerkkejä

123 Ala abs_esimerkki ()MsgBox -loki (100)End Sub

Tämä koodi palauttaa 4.60517018598809

Lokin syntaksi

VBA -editorissa voit kirjoittaa "Loki" nähdäksesi lokitoiminnon syntaksin:

Lokitoiminto sisältää argumentin:

Määrä: Mikä tahansa kelvollinen numeerinen lauseke, joka on suurempi kuin nolla.

Esimerkkejä Excel VBA -lokitoiminnosta

1 MsgBox -loki (10)

Tulos: 2.30258509299405

1 MsgBox -loki (32)

Tulos: 3.46573590279973

Kaikki yllä olevat esimerkit ovat tapauksia, joissa on pohja e (luonnollisen logaritmin perusta).

Voit laskea logaritmin millä tahansa kantalla käyttämällä koodia seuraavana funktiona.

12345678 Toiminto LogAny (b Kuten kaksinkertainen, x Kuten kaksinkertainen) Kaksinkertaisena'b: kanta x: annettu lukuLogAny = Loki (x) / Loki (b)Lopeta toimintoAliloki_esimerkki1 ()MsgBox LogAny (10, 100)End Sub

Tulos on seuraava.

wave wave wave wave wave